Harsh is a unique and powerful name with Indian origins. In Sanskrit, "Harsh" translates to "happiness" or "joy," embodying a sense of positivity and brightness. The name holds cultural significance in Hindu traditions, symbolizing the celebration of life and the pursuit of inner contentment. Historically, individuals named "Harsh" were often seen as bearers of good fortune and happiness, bringing light and joy to those around them. Today, the name "Harsh" continues to represent a sense of optimism and happiness, making it a popular choice for parents seeking a name that exudes positivity and warmth.
